Purpose: Oral isotretinoin (13-cis retinoic acid, 13-cis RA) was approved for severe acne treatment by the FDA in 1982. The ocular side effects associated with oral isotretinoin use are mostly dose-dependent. Numerous ocular pathologies affect peripapillary choroidal layer primarily or indirectly.

Objective: Evaluation of the peripapillary choroidal layer in the patients receiving oral isotretinoin therapy may aid in explaining the pathophysiology of ocular side effects.

Methods: In this study, peripapillary choroidal thickness was assessed in the patients receiving oral isotretinoin treatment via optical coherent tomography technique.

Results: Significant difference was found in the superotemporal and temporal areas.

Conclusion: Oral isotretinoin treatment may affect the thickness of the peripapillary choroidal layer.  相似文献

Background: Lavender oil consists of around 100 components and is susceptible to volatilisation and degradation reactions.

Aim: Microencapsulate lavender oil by spray drying using a biocompatible polymeric blend of gum acacia and maltodextrin to protect the oil components. Effect of total polymer content, oil loading, gum acacia, and maltodextrin proportions on the size, yield, loading, and encapsulation efficiency of the microparticles was investigated.

Methods: Morphology and oil localisation within microparticles were assessed by confocal laser scanning electron microscope. Structural preservation and compatibility were assessed using Fourier transform infra-red spectroscopy, differential scanning calorimetry, and gas chromatography–mass spectrometry.

Results: Lavender microparticles of size 12.42?±?1.79?µm prepared at 30 w/w% polymer concentration, 16.67 w/w% oil loading, and 25w/w% gum acacia showed maximum oil protection at high loading (12?mg w/w%), and encapsulation efficiency (77.89 w/w%).

Conclusion: Lavender oil was successfully microencapsulated into stable microparticles by spray drying using gum acacia/maltodextrin polymeric blend.  相似文献

Background: Gait disorders are common in Parkinson’s disease patients who respond poorly to dopaminergic treatment. Blockade of adenosine A2A receptors is expected to improve gait disorders. Istradefylline is a first-in-class selective adenosine A2A receptor antagonist with benefits for motor complications associated with Parkinson’s disease.

Research design and methods: This multicenter, open-label, single-group, prospective interventional study evaluated changes in total gait-related scores of the Part II/III Movement Disorder Society-Unified Parkinson’s Disease Rating Scale (MDS-UPDRS) and Freezing of Gait Questionnaire (FOG-Q) in 31 Parkinson’s disease patients treated with istradefylline. Gait analysis by portable gait rhythmogram was performed.

Results: MDS-UPDRS Part III gait-related total scores significantly decreased at Weeks 4–12 from baseline with significant improvements in gait, freezing of gait, and postural stability. Significant decreases in MDS-UPDRS Part II total scores and individual item scores at Week 12 indicated improved daily living activities. At Week 12, there were significant improvements in FOG-Q, new FOG-Q, and overall movement per 48 h measured by portable gait rhythmogram. Adverse events occurred in 7/31 patients.

Conclusions: Istradefylline improved gait disorders in Parkinson’s disease patients complicated with freezing of gait, improving their quality of life. No unexpected adverse drug reactions were identified.

Introduction: Novel drug discovery remains an enormous challenge, with various computer-aided drug design (CADD) approaches having been widely employed for this purpose. CADD, specifically the commonly used support vector machines (SVMs), can employ machine learning techniques. SVMs and their variations offer numerous drug discovery applications, which range from the classification of substances (as active or inactive) to the construction of regression models and the ranking/virtual screening of databased compounds.

Areas covered: Herein, the authors consider some of the applications of SVMs in medicinal chemistry, illustrating their main advantages and disadvantages, as well as trends in their utilization, via the available published literature. The aim of this review is to provide an up-to-date review of the recent applications of SVMs in drug discovery as described by the literature, thereby highlighting their strengths, weaknesses, and future challenges.

Expert opinion: Techniques based on SVMs are considered as powerful approaches in early drug discovery. The ability of SVMs to classify active or inactive compounds has enabled the prioritization of substances for virtual screening. Indeed, one of the main advantages of SVMs is related to their potential in the analysis of nonlinear problems. However, despite successes in employing SVMs, the challenges of improving accuracy remain.  相似文献

Introduction: Our understanding of the complexity of cardiovascular disease pathophysiology remains very incomplete and has hampered cardiovascular drug development over recent decades. The prevalence of cardiovascular diseases and their increasing global burden call for novel strategies to address disease biology and drug discovery.

Areas covered: This review describes the recent history of cardiovascular drug discovery using in vivo phenotype-based screening in zebrafish. The rationale for the use of this model is highlighted and the initial efforts in the fields of disease modeling and high-throughput screening are illustrated. Finally, the advantages and limitations of in vivo zebrafish screening are discussed, highlighting newer approaches, such as genome editing technologies, to accelerate our understanding of disease biology and the development of precise disease models.

Expert opinion: Full understanding and faithful modeling of specific cardiovascular disease is a rate-limiting step for cardiovascular drug discovery. The resurgence of in vivo phenotype screening together with the advancement of systems biology approaches allows for the identification of lead compounds which show efficacy on integrative disease biology in the absence of validated targets. This strategy bypasses current gaps in knowledge of disease biology and paves the way for successful drug discovery and downstream molecular target identification.  相似文献

Introduction and aims: To explore routine care interventions which enable parents to support the therapeutic effort of their adult child in drug and alcohol treatment.

Design and methods: Inductive content analysis was used to analyze the experiences of 31 Greek addiction professionals who participated in focus groups.

Findings: Professionals adopted various interventions which included (a) respond to parents quest for help, (b) involvement of the distant parent in treatment, (c) boundary setting, (d) facilitation of parent-child communication, and (e) support of parental changes. These interventions were perceived as necessary, both for motivating and sustaining the client’s change, and for alleviating the parents’ chronic grief and distress over their child’s addiction.

Conclusion: Overall, addiction professionals perceived low intensity interventions, information giving, and non- judgmental informal interactions as catalysts for the parents involvement in addiction treatment.  相似文献

Objectives: The objective of this study was the evaluation of the professional exposure to nanoparticles during tasks performed in workstations for production of metallic parts by laser welding additive manufacturing.

Materials and methods: The study was developed in an installed additive manufacturing machine, having controlled temperature and humidity in an industrial unit where metal parts were being produced using stainless steel powders of granulometry of 10 to 35?μm.

Results and discussion: Monitoring of airborne nanoparticles emission was made using adequate equipment, which showed considerable number of nanoparticles over the baseline, having the same composition as the steel powder used.

Conclusion: It is concluded that the values of professional exposure to nanoparticles are high in these workstations and that the nanoparticles to which the workers are exposed are small in size (around 15?nm), thus having a strong capacity for alveolar penetration and, consequently, with a strong possibility of passing to the bloodstream, accumulating in the body.  相似文献

Introduction: The expansion of label free mass spectrometry into early drug discovery was always predicted to provide improvements in data quality and depth with the potential to reduce costs but has previously been limited by throughput. There are several techniques that vary by sample introduction technology or ionization technique that try to address the challenges in this area.

Areas covered: In this review, the authors describe the deployment of such a device, combining acoustic mist ionization and time-of-flight mass spectrometry. The potential impact of this instrument is discussed with case studies reporting screening across a series of enzyme target classes and chemical triage assays which have generated early chemical equity for drug projects.

Expert opinion: In our expert opinion, we look forward to the large-scale adoption of mass spectrometry as a high throughput screening approach. The expansion of applications enabled by these technologies such as triage assays and metabolic profiling will also be explored.  相似文献

Background: Several studies indicate that lifetime abuse is a relevant risk factor for suicidal ideation and/or attempts. However, little is known about this phenomenon in patients seeking treatment for substance use disorder. The prevalence rate of suicidal ideation and/or suicide attempts was explored among lifetime physically and/or sexually abused patients receiving treatment for drug addiction. The differential characteristics between these patients and those without suicidal behaviours were studied.

Method: Three hundred and seventy-five patients were assessed. Socio-demographic characteristics, addiction severity, lifetime abuse, suicidal ideation and attempts, and psychopathological symptoms were explored.

Results: Eighty-two patients (21.9%) presented with a history of lifetime abuse and were included in the study (37 men and 45 women). Sixty-two per cent of them presented with lifetime suicidal ideation (12.2% in the last month), and 30.5% with suicide attempts (1.2% in the last month). Patients with suicidal ideation or attempts showed a more severe addiction profile (assessed by the EuropASI) and more psychopathological symptoms (assessed by the SCL-90-R).

Conclusion: This study highlights the relationship between previous traumatic experiences and suicidal behaviours. According to these results, systematic screening of suicidal risk in patients seeking treatment in addiction centres with histories of abuse is recommended.  相似文献

Introduction: Renal ischemia-reperfusion injury (IRI) is a significant clinical challenge faced by clinicians in a broad variety of clinical settings such as perioperative and intensive care. Renal IRI induced acute kidney injury (AKI) is a global public health concern associated with high morbidity, mortality, and health-care costs.

Areas covered: This paper focuses on the pathophysiology of transplantation-related AKI and recent findings on cellular stress responses at the intersection of 1. The Unfolded protein response; 2. Mitochondrial dysfunction; 3. The benefits of mineralocorticoid receptor antagonists. Lastly, perspectives are offered to the readers.

Expert opinion: Renal IRI is caused by a sudden and temporary impairment of blood flow to the organ.

Defining the underlying cellular cascades involved in IRI will assist us in the identification of novel interventional targets to attenuate IRI with the potential to improve transplantation outcomes. Targeting mitochondrial function and cellular bioenergetics upstream of cellular damage may offer several advantages compared to targeting downstream inflammatory and fibrosis processes.

An improved understanding of the cellular pathophysiological mechanisms leading to kidney injury will hopefully offer improved targeted therapies to prevent and treat the injury in the future.  相似文献

Background: Smartphone overuse has become prevalent worldwide. The aim of this study is to develop a self-administered scale, the Smartphone Overuse Classification Scale (SOCS) that can be used to screen for different types of smartphone overuse.

Methods: The SOCS consists of three subscales: social network app overuse (S-scale), recreational app overuse (R-scale), and information overload (I-scale). A total of 849 participants were recruited to complete questionnaires, including the SOCS, Young’s Diagnosis Questionnaire (Young’s DQ) and a demographic data form.

Results: Three factors (cognitive disorder, behavioral disorder, and mood disorder) were extracted from each subscale of the SOCS, and these explained over 60% of the variance of each subscale. The Cronbach’s alpha was 0.849 for the SOCS and 0.813, 0.726, and 0.706 for the S-scale, R-scale and I-scale, respectively. Intra-class correlations for the SOCS and its subscales ranged from 0.768 to 0.879. The SOCS and its subscales were moderately or highly correlated with Young’s DQ.

Conclusions: The SOCS may provide a basis for developing specific intervention schemes for different types of smartphone overuse.  相似文献

Background: Cannabis is the second most commonly used substance after alcohol among people seeking treatment for other drug use, but no statistics are available regarding secondary cannabis use among drug treatment clients.

Objectives: To investigate levels of secondary cannabis use among drug treatment clients and perceived need for support addressing this use among clients and staff.

Methods: Cross-sectional surveys of clients (N?=?295) and staff (N?=?33) were conducted in 2015 at four London drug and alcohol treatment services. Client measures included recent drug use, type of cannabis used, Severity of Dependence Scale for cannabis, and views on secondary cannabis use treatment. Staff measures included definition of problem cannabis use, importance and timing for addressing secondary cannabis use.

Results: Among clients, 39.7% reported recent secondary cannabis use, with 30.8% of these clients meeting criteria for problem use. Problem users were more likely to be interested in receiving treatment for cannabis use than non-problem users (51.4% versus 10.8%, p?<?.001). Nearly half of staff (48.5%) thought secondary cannabis use should be addressed early in treatment.

Conclusions: Two out of five drug treatment clients used cannabis and a third experienced cannabis-related problems. Many are willing to address cannabis use, but defined treatment pathways are needed.  相似文献

1. The utility of 1-aminobenzotriazole (ABT), incorporated in food, has been investigated as an approach for longer term inhibition of cytochrome P450 (P450) enzymes in mice.

2. In rats, ABT inhibits gastric emptying, to investigate this potential limitation in mice we examined the effect of ABT administration on the oral absorption of NVS-CRF38. Two hour prior oral treatment with 100?mg/kg ABT inhibited the oral absorption of NVS-CRF38, Tmax was 4?hours for ABT-treated mice compared to 0.5?hours in the control group.

3. A marked inhibition of hepatic P450 activity was observed in mice fed with ABT containing food pellets for 1?month. P450 activity, as measured by the oral clearance of antipyrine, was inhibited on day 3 (88% of control), week 2 (83% of control) and week 4 (80% of control).

4. Tmax values for antipyrine were comparable between ABT-treated mice and the control group, alleviating concerns about impaired gastric function.

5. Inclusion of ABT in food provides a minimally invasive and convenient approach to achieve longer term inhibition of P450 activity in mice. This model has the potential to enable pharmacological proof-of-concept studies for research compounds which are extensively metabolised by P450 enzymes.  相似文献

Background: The aims of the study were to assess subclinical organ damage in men and women with hypertension and its subsequent effect on cardiovascular risk, and use of new statistical methods for more precise estimation of cardiovascular risk using vascular cardiovascular risk factors: ankle–brachial index (ABI), intima–media thickness (IMT) and pulse wave velocity (PWV).

Methods: We studied 200 patients: 100 hypertensive and 100 normotensive. The parameters we evaluated included: patient age, ABI, IMT, PWV, serum uric acid and serum C-reactive protein (CRP). In addition, the cardiovascular risk according to the SCORE and Framingham scales was assessed.

Results: In the hypertensive group, there were significant correlations between ABI and the Framingham scale in both sexes. In hypertensive women, there were also significant correlations between IMT and the SCORE scale risk, and IMT and the Framingham scale risk.

In normotensive women, there were significant correlations between ABI and the SCORE scale risk, and between ABI and the Framingham scale risk. In normotensive men, there were significant correlations between PWV and the SCORE scale risk, and between PWV and the Framingham scale risk. Lastly, in the group of normotensive men, there were significant correlations between IMT and the SCORE scale risk, and IMT and the Framingham scale risk.

The possibility of correctly classifying a patient into the high-risk category by a logistic regression model using synchronous ABI, IMT and PWV was high – 74% for the risk according to the SCORE scale (66% in men, 88% in women), and 98% for the Framingham scale.

Conclusions: The addition of recognized subclinical target organ damage tests to the estimation of cardiovascular risk can significantly strengthen the prevention of cardiovascular disease.

Cardiovascular risk estimation follow-up with ABI, PWV and IMT increased the probability of correctly classifying people, especially women, into an at least high-risk category according to the SCORE scale, which has valuable therapeutic implications.  相似文献

Objective: We have previously found that mesenchymal stem cell (MSC) therapy can ameliorate phosgene-induced acute lung injury (ALI). Moreover, exosomes can be used as a cell-free alternative therapy. In the present study, we aimed to assess the effect of MSC-derived exosomes on phosgene-induced ALI.

Methods: MSC-derived exosomes were isolated from MSCs through ultracentrifugation. Sprague-Dawley (SD) rats were exposed to phosgene at 8.33?g/m3 for 5?min. MSC-derived exosomes were intratracheally administered and rats were sacrificed at the time points of 6, 24 and 48?h.

Results: Compared with the phosgene group, MSC-derived exosomes reversed respiratory function alterations, showing increased levels of TV, PIF, PEF and EF50 as well as decreased levels of RI and EEP. Furthermore, MSC-derived exosomes improved pathological alterations and reduced wet-to-dry ratio and total protein content in BALF. MSC-derived exosomes reduced the levels of TNF-α, IL-1β and IL-6 and increased the IL-10 level in BALF and plasma. MSC-derived exosomes suppressed the MMP-9 level and increased the SP-C level.

Conclusions: MSC-derived exosomes exerted beneficial effects on phosgene-induced ALI via modulating inflammation, inhibiting MMP-9 synthesis and elevating SP-C level.  相似文献

Aims: To evaluate (i) the types of techniques alcohol marketers utilise to facilitate user engagement with content on leading Indian and Australian Twitter alcohol brand pages and (ii) the extent to which users engage with this content in two diverse national contexts.

Methods: The 10 alcohol brands per country with the greatest Twitter presence were identified based on the number of ‘followers’. Number of tweets, photos, and videos were collected and the type of content noted for each brand between 1 January 2016 and 29 February 2016. The data were analysed via an inductive coding approach using NVivo10.

Results: In total, the brands had accumulated up to 150,386 followers (Indian: 110,032; Australian: 40,354). The techniques utilised were a mix of those that differed by country (e.g. India: sexually suggestive content versus Australia: posts related to the brand’s tradition or heritage) and generic approaches (e.g. alcohol sponsorship of sport, music, and fashion; offering consumption suggestions; organising competitions; giveaways; and use of memes).

Conclusions: The flexibility of Twitter, which complements traditional marketing, allows brands to adapt and deliver their online alcohol content in specific national contexts and to capitalise on the cultural meanings users invoke in their interactions with the brands.  相似文献

Aims: To review existing evidence on effectiveness of community-based diversion programmes for Class A drug-using offenders.

Methods: 31 databases were searched for studies published 1985–2012 (update search 2012–2016) involving community-based Criminal Justice System diversion of Class A drug users via voluntary or court-mandated treatment.

Findings: 16 studies were initially included (US, 10; UK, 4; Canada, 1; Australia, 1). There was evidence for a small impact of diversion to treatment on drug use reduction (primary Class A drug use: OR 1.68, CI 1.12–2.53; other drug use: OR 2.60, 1.70–3.98). Class A drug users were less likely to complete treatment (OR 0.90, 0.87–0.94) than users of other drugs. There was uncertainty surrounding results for offending, which were not pooled due to lack of outcome measure comparability and heterogeneity. Individual studies pointed to a minor effect of diversion on offending. Findings remained unchanged following an update review (evidence up to March 2016: US, 3; Australia, 1).

Conclusions: Treatment accessed via community-based diversion is effective at reducing drug use in Class A drug-using offenders. Evidence of a reduction in offending amongst this group as a result of diversion is uncertain. Poor methodological quality and data largely limited to US methamphetamine users limits available evidence.  相似文献

Aims: This paper focuses on the reasons for the under-representation of British South Asians in substance use services. Based on a small-scale evaluation of a substance use service that delivers targeted outreach support within two predominantly Pakistani and Bangladeshi communities in the north west of England, this paper contributes to the debate around how substance use services can best engage with young British Pakistani and Bangladeshi substance users.

Methods: Semi-structured interviews (with six staff members, 18 young Pakistani and Bangladeshi service users, and 18 stakeholders and partner agencies), a detailed ethnographic observation of the service, and an analysis of routinely collected quantitative monitoring data.

Findings: The paper highlights the importance of what Fountain terms low threshold/open access services. Alongside this, the paper argues that the building of trust and confidence in a substance use service is a key when it comes to engaging with young Pakistani and Bangladeshi substance users. Yet this necessary process takes time: something that is at odds with the current trend towards short-term funding regimes and ‘quick wins’.

Conclusions: The paper concludes by advocating the need for, not only a diverse range of engagement strategies, but also a longer term approach when it comes to developing and delivering substance use services aimed at successfully engaging with this particular group of substance users.  相似文献
